After another complain on #kernelnewbies about the OOM killer doing
strange thingss, by killing small processes when its really not needed,
and not doing anything when its really OOM i ran out of nerves and came out
with an idea, which i believe already settled down is some brains.
I speak about providing in /proc list of process badnesses, possibly with
some additional info...
Its just a shame to have a stable kernel randomly killing processes even when
its not needed...
